UP CM donates Rs. 5 Crore towards PMNRF
Dec 5th, 2017 10:14 am | By ThenewsmanofIndia.com | Category: LATEST NEWSTHE NEWSMAN OF INDIA.COM
Chief Minister of Uttar Pradesh, Yogi Adityanath called on the Prime Minister Narendra Modi today in New Delhi. He handed over a cheque worth Rs. Five Crore to the Prime Minister from Chief Minister Distress Relief Fund (CMDRF) towards Prime Minister’s National Relief Fund (PMNRF), for the Cyclone affected people in Lakshadweep and other States.
